Twitch Enhances Reporting and Appeals Process with New Updates

Twitch Introduces New Features to Improve Transparency and User Control

Twitch, the popular livestream platform for gaming, has announced the release of two new features aimed at addressing user frustrations with reporting and suspension appeals.

Content creators on Twitch have often criticized the lack of transparency surrounding user suspensions. To address this issue, Twitch has launched an “appeals portal” that provides users with more clarity and control over the appeals process. The appeals portal went live today.

According to Twitch, the appeals portal is designed to speed up the appeals process and offer users more information about the status of their appeal. Its main goal is to make the appeals process more transparent for users.

However, it’s important to note that this update only focuses on improving the transparency of the appeals process itself. Some content creators have expressed concerns about not understanding the reasons for their suspensions. Unfortunately, this update does not directly address those concerns.

To access the appeals portal, content creators can find it in the drop-down menu under “Safety” in their account’s profile.

Additionally, Twitch is implementing an updated reporting system to simplify the process for users. This new reporting system, which will be introduced next week, aims to make reporting other users more intuitive and streamlined.
